A realistic roleplay-based training video created for ICICI Bank to demonstrate how banking executives can effectively pitch products to inbound customer calls. Filmed with professional actors in a simulated bank environment, this video makes soft skill and sales training engaging, repeatable, and cost-effective for HR and L\&D teams.
Training Video on SOP Guidelines for Axis Bank showcases effective methods to impart soft skills, sales strategies, and service training to employees and partners across multiple locations. It reduces training fatigue on HR teams while maintaining uniformity and clarity across the workforce.
A well-designed patient education video can significantly improve treatment adherence and therapeutic outcomes. This instructional film for Zolmist Nasal Spray was developed to demonstrate the correct administration technique for patients managing acute migraine episodes, helping reduce misuse while improving confidence in self-administration.
A concise yet highly detailed clinical training film developed for Cipla Critical Care to standardize the reconstitution process for Tazact across hospitals and healthcare institutions. The video combines procedural accuracy with visual clarity to support nurses, pharmacists, doctors, and clinical teams in maintaining sterility, dosage accuracy, and compliance during critical care administration workflows.
Created to improve awareness and participation in the Computing Intelligence Olympiad among Marathi speaking students and educational institutions, this regional language promotional AV translated a technology-focused academic initiative into an engaging, relatable, and accessible communication tool for schools, parents, and young learners across Maharashtra.
As part of Pantaloons' internal Brand Talk initiative, this corporate training video transformed visual merchandising expertise into a scalable learning asset for retail teams across India. Featuring practical insights from the Richard Parkar visual merchandising team, the project helped standardize in-store execution, strengthen brand consistency, and support sales performance across a large-format fashion retail network.
